WinForm运行一段时间后自动关闭【问题总汇】

1.线程创建的太多了

================================

 

2.遇到未捕获的异常。
在 Main 方法中的Application.Run之前写一句:

C# code
Application.ThreadException += new System.Threading.ThreadExceptionEventHandler(Application_ThreadException);
Main方法外面写:

C# code
        static void Application_ThreadException(object sender, System.Threading.ThreadExceptionEventArgs e)       

 {            MessageBox.Show("程序需要重新启动:" + e.Exception.Message);//捕获到的异常        }
 这样就会显示异常信息。

posted on 2011-07-13 10:21  飞舞的蒲公英  阅读(2187)  评论(0)    收藏  举报